Color-coded Lead Sheets for Jazz Combo. Separate lead sheets for Concert instruments and Bb instruments included with purchase. Color allows quick understanding of the sections and form of the tune, the rhythmic hits, and the counter-melodies. Special care has been taken to clearly indicate intros, sections, solos, and codas/outros. These form-based markings are in GREEN. Special care has also been taken to notate the rhythmic hits. Hits are notated above the staff, in RED. Finally, any counter-melodies or harmonies appear in reduced size, in BLUE."Thinking of George" has a rock feel throughout, and like the above song, alternates from a slow "A" section to a fast , double-time bridge. Inspired by teacher George Russell, inventor of the Lydian Chromatic concept, the soloist plays upper structure chords over the fundamental chord changes of the song.
